
Courses required to obtain the Transition DPT degree for SAU MPT alumni and graduates of other accredited programs are summarized below. In conjunction with the application procedure, a portfolio review will be conducted. Once accepted into the Transition DPT program students will work with their advisor to develop their individual plan of study.

NOTE: Students not yet admitted into the program may take or transfer no more than six (6) credit hours as a non-degree seeking student, based upon class availability and approval of the course instructor.
